SALA Rollpump® - Extremely high viscous media pumping

|
Pumping extremely high viscous media is made easier by injecting water into the suction nozzle. The water reduces the friction between the oil and hose.
A series of pump tests were conducted from October to December 2004 to measure the suction capability of the Sala roll pump with high viscous oil.
The tests were carried out with and without water injection in the suction nozzle.
The results indicate that the limit without water injection was approximately 3,500,000 cSt at shear rate 0.07 S-1 .
With water injection the capacity was increased to approximately 65% of the nominal capacity at a viscosity around 4,500,000 cSt with the same shear rate of 0.07 S-1.

High viscous pump: Suitable for pumping debris laden viscous oil
Sala clean up system for oil and chemicals is a unique patented system designed for rescue and clean up of oil spills and other high viscous and polluted liquids.
The extremely strong suction (vacuum) and the debris tolerance of 40mm, (1 1/2") solids make it suitable for pumping debris laden viscous oil. The extremely high discharge pressure makes it possible for liquids to flow through a long distance of hose. The combination of handling weight and portability enables the user to deploy the system in remote areas.

Sala roll pump is unique because the pump is a peristaltic type of suction and pressure pump that delivers extremely high vacuum. This makes it possible to lift high viscous liquids from the ground such as bunker oil at temperatures around the freezing point.
The high discharge pressure makes it possible for liquids to flow through along distance of hose. No valves obstruct the free flow of pulp through the pump and 40 mm, (1 1/2”) solids can pass without damaging the pump. Lost protection gloves and other safety items which clog seals or cause damage can pass through the system without any problems. Should a blockage occur, the hydraulic drive system can be reversed to clear the pump. The Sala system can also pump corrosive chemicals such as ammonia, nitric, sulfuric acid, chlorine etc.
The Sala roll pump system can be used for chemical cleanup as no mechanical components will come in contact with the discharged media. The hose inside the pump housing is made of nitril which is resistant to many chemicals. Other hose material can be supplied on request.
Combination of high temperatures and aggressive chemicals may reduce the lifetime of the hose. It is recommended to replace the pumphose after a cleanup of aggressive chemicals.
Importantly, the Sala roll pump can handle temperatures of 100 degrees C (212 degrees F) and may increase to 130 degrees C (266 degrees F).
